Fork us on GitHub Follow us on Facebook Follow us on Twitter

Changeset 19b3cc6 in mainline for boot/arch/arm32/include/main.h


Ignore:
Timestamp:
2014-01-17T23:12:10Z (8 years ago)
Author:
Jan Vesely <jano.vesely@…>
Branches:
lfn, master
Children:
e26a9d95
Parents:
fddffb2 (diff), facc34d (diff)
Note: this is a merge changeset, the changes displayed below correspond to the merge itself.
Use the (diff) links above to see all the changes relative to each parent.
Message:

Merge libdrv-cleanup branch (includes mainline changes)

File:
1 edited

Legend:

Unmodified
Added
Removed
  • boot/arch/arm32/include/main.h

    rfddffb2 r19b3cc6  
    7575#define ICP_SCONS_ADDR          0x16000000
    7676
     77/** Raspberry PI serial console registers */
     78#define BCM2835_UART0_BASE      0x20201000
     79#define BCM2835_UART0_DR        (BCM2835_UART0_BASE + 0x00)
     80#define BCM2835_UART0_FR        (BCM2835_UART0_BASE + 0x18)
     81#define BCM2835_UART0_ILPR      (BCM2835_UART0_BASE + 0x20)
     82#define BCM2835_UART0_IBRD      (BCM2835_UART0_BASE + 0x24)
     83#define BCM2835_UART0_FBRD      (BCM2835_UART0_BASE + 0x28)
     84#define BCM2835_UART0_LCRH      (BCM2835_UART0_BASE + 0x2C)
     85#define BCM2835_UART0_CR        (BCM2835_UART0_BASE + 0x30)
     86#define BCM2835_UART0_ICR       (BCM2835_UART0_BASE + 0x44)
     87
     88#define BCM2835_UART0_FR_TXFF   (1 << 5)
     89#define BCM2835_UART0_LCRH_FEN  (1 << 4)
     90#define BCM2835_UART0_LCRH_WL8  ((1 << 5) | (1 << 6))
     91#define BCM2835_UART0_CR_UARTEN (1 << 0)
     92#define BCM2835_UART0_CR_TXE    (1 << 8)
     93#define BCM2835_UART0_CR_RXE    (1 << 9)
     94
     95
     96
    7797extern void bootstrap(void);
    7898
Note: See TracChangeset for help on using the changeset viewer.